Open-pit gold mining operations face mounting cost pressures as crude oil prices remain elevated, according to recent analysis from Jefferies. The investment bank's mining team, led by senior analyst Fahad Tariq, has issued a cautionary outlook on the sector, emphasizing that cost inflation is not a matter of if but when for open-pit gold producers. This assessment carries significant implications for mining companies and investors, as operational expenses directly impact profitability and project viability.
The vulnerability of open-pit gold miners to oil price fluctuations stems from their energy-intensive operational models. Open-pit mining requires substantial diesel fuel consumption for fleet operations, including haul trucks, excavators, and other heavy machinery that form the backbone of extraction activities. Additionally, oil prices influence transportation costs for equipment, supplies, and final product logistics. Unlike underground mining operations, which can benefit from some efficiency gains through deeper, more concentrated ore bodies, open-pit operations inherently demand continuous large-scale earthmoving and processing, making them disproportionately sensitive to energy cost volatility.
Jefferies' analysis reflects broader industry concerns about cost management in a challenging macroeconomic environment. The gold mining sector has already contended with inflation in labor, materials, and services over recent years. With crude oil prices maintaining elevated levels compared to historical averages, open-pit operators face a dual squeeze: they cannot easily reduce production volumes without abandoning capital investments, yet higher energy costs directly erode operating margins. This creates a particularly acute problem for lower-grade open-pit operations, where profitability depends on scale and operational efficiency.
The implications of this cost pressure vary across the industry. Large-cap gold producers with diversified asset portfolios and strong cash generation capabilities may better absorb elevated operating costs, though it will constrain capital allocation for expansion and shareholder returns. Mid-tier and junior open-pit operators, however, face more existential challenges. Some projects may transition from profitable to marginal or uneconomical if oil prices remain elevated for extended periods, potentially forcing operational shutdowns or accelerated mine closures.
This analysis also highlights competitive dynamics shifting within the gold sector. Underground mining operations, while facing their own cost challenges, may become relatively more attractive on a comparative basis. Similarly, high-margin, low-cost open-pit operations in jurisdictions with energy advantages—such as those with access to hydroelectric power or abundant natural gas—could gain competitive advantages during periods of elevated crude oil prices.
